Transaction 155e2ee6965cc311a22378741a8dd5a15c61a0628b30e81685c4b55d892bf879
1 Input
2 Outputs
- 155e2ee6965cc311a22378741a8dd5a15c61a0628b30e81685c4b55d892bf879:0
- 155e2ee6965cc311a22378741a8dd5a15c61a0628b30e81685c4b55d892bf879:1
value 463137
address 1FyCHhHTCFi7QHzGKmNP8L8zbKe7ByvftC
value 1162109
address 3DHcKw9WoPRzAr3u7jjHRo4557ir1zsDmk